The Pittsburgh Steelers acquired Miles Killebrew after his five-season tenure with the Detroit Lions. Initially signing him to a one-year deal in 2021, the Steelers extended Killebrew's contract in 2022 with a two-year, $4 million deal, recognizing his exceptional performance on special teams.

Patrick Queen had a banner year with Baltimore last season, recording 133 tackles, nine tackles for loss, 3.5 sacks, six quarterback hits, six passes defended, one interception and one forced fumble.
